How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Countyline?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Countyline Studio Apartments | $641 | $625 | $650 |
| Countyline 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,028 | $195 | $2,011 |
| Countyline 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,364 | $250 | $2,670 |
| Countyline 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,401 | $925 | $2,987 |
| Countyline 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,325 | $1,250 | $1,474 |

Cheapest Available Countyline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Countyline, OK is a 1 Bed unit found at Arrow Motel Extended Stay priced from $195. Avalon of Lawton has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$500.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Countyline ap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Arrow Motel Extended Stay | Weekly Rental | 1BR,1BA | $195 |
| Avalon of Lawton | 1 bedroom - Floor Plan 2 | 1BR,1BA | $500 |
| Camden Apartments and Townhomes | 1 bedroom, 1 bath small | 1BR,1BA | $535 |
| Ozmun Apartments | 1 BEDROOM | 1BR,1BA | $595 |
| Regency Apartments | 1 Bed | 1BR,1BA | $600 |
| Timbers | Studio | Studio,1BA | $625 |
| Blue Sky Apartments | Studio | Studio,1BA | $650 |
| Candlewood Apartments | Charming 2-Bedroom, 1-Bath Apartment Convenient... | 2BR,1BA | $695 |
| Essa View Apartments | 1BR/1BA | 1BR,1BA | $700 |
| Sandpiper Apartments | Perfect place to call home! | 2BR,1BA | $745 |
